大连港西区C03-3地块异形平面超高层住宅结构设计

[摘要]大连港西区C03-3地块超高层住宅1#楼为一栋三个单元转角拼接建筑,结构体系为钢筋混凝土剪力墙结构。详细介绍超限设计的主要内容,分析异形平面剪力墙结构在地震作用下的受力特点,针对因偏心导致扭转效应明显问题提出相应的措施,对处于薄弱部位的转角及细腰处楼板进行加强,关注不同方向地震作用下受拉剪力墙位置变化并进行性能设计。结构抗震性能设计结果表明结构可以满足预定的抗震性能目标。

[关键词]超高层结构; 抗震性能目标; 异形平面结构; 抗震设计

Structural design of super high-rise residential building with special plane of No.C03-3 Plot in Gangxi District of Dalian

Abstract:The super high\|rise building 1# of No.C03-3 Plot in Gangxi District of Dalian is joined by three units at corners, and it adopts RC shear wall structure. The main content of the out-of-code design was introduced in detail. The mechanical features of the shear wall structure with special plane under earthquake action were analyzed. The corresponding measures were put forward to tackle obvious torsion effect caused by eccentricity. The floors in the corner of weak parts and at the waist parts were reinforced. Changes of position of tensile shear walls under different earthquake actions were concerned and relevant performance-based seismic design was carried out. The results of performance-based seismic design of the structure show that the structure can meet the expected seismic performance objectives.

Keywords:super high-rise building; seismic performance objective; structure with special plane; seismic design
